33得票8回答
Node.js抱怨“当前路径上找不到ChromeDriver”,即使chromedriver在路径上。

我正在Linux上使用Node 5.10.0。 运行脚本时遇到一些问题,如下所示:[davea@mydevbox mydir]$ node SkyNet.js Validation Complete /home/davea/node_modules/selenium-webdriver/ch...

7得票1回答
Chromedriver在无头模式下无法截屏?

我正在使用新的Chrome驱动程序无头模式(Chrome v59,Mac OS)与webdriver。但不幸的是,在无头模式下提供的截图选项对我不起作用。以下代码显示了配置的Chrome选项。 chromeOptions.addArguments("headless"); chromeOpt...

7得票5回答
Python:如何在Selenium中隐藏Chrome输出消息?

我想做什么: 我想使用Selenium ChromeDriver打开Chrome浏览器,但不希望Chrome信息输出到控制台。 我的做法: from selenium import webdriver driver = webdriver.Chrome(r'C:\Users\u1\Doc...

12得票1回答
Selenium在执行一段时间后,所有网站都会出现“Timed out receiving message from renderer”的错误

我有一个应用程序,需要一个长时间运行的Selenium web驱动实例(我正在使用Chrome Driver 83.0.4103.39以无头模式运行)。基本上,该应用程序会不断从队列中拉取URL数据,并将提取到的URL传递给Selenium,在网站上执行一些分析。其中许多网站可能会失效、无法访...

9得票5回答
使用ChromeDriver无法下载文件

我正在使用selenium和chromedriver从应用程序下载文件。但是,在单击应用程序中的下载按钮时,会出现“Failed-Download error.”错误。 Chromedriver版本:2.21 Selenium版本:2.53.0 初始化ChromeDriver并更改...

7得票1回答
C# Selenium Chrome端口问题?

我正在尝试使用C#和Chrome浏览器来运行Selenium,但连接失败了。 我的代码如下: string site = "https://google.de"; IWebDriver driver = new ChromeDriver(@"C:\test\"); driver.Navig...

37得票7回答
使用Python通过ChromeDriver和Chrome运行Selenium时出现selenium.common.exceptions.WebDriverException: Message: invalid session id错误。

我正在使用Selenium编写一些代码,其中有一点需要进行7个请求,分别是对不同的网站。对于第一个请求,一切正常。但是,对于其他请求,我会收到一个会话ID错误。我认为我的浏览器已经正确配置了,因为我确实从第一个网站获得了结果。我尝试在请求之间放置了一个WebDriverWait,但无济于事。我...

9得票5回答
如何使用Chrome驱动程序和Java覆盖Selenium2中的基本身份验证?

如何在selenium2 chrome driver中覆盖基本身份验证? 在我的项目中遇到了一个问题,Chrome“需要身份验证”的弹出窗口正在阻止webdriver继续导航。 请参见附加的屏幕截图。 我使用以下代码来实例化chrome driver: private WebDriver ...

10得票1回答
Debian 10 Buster中缺少ChromeDriver。

现在许多官方Docker镜像都基于Debian Buster。我们以前在基于Stretch的镜像中安装chromedriver包,但现在这个包已经不可用了。

15得票4回答
使用Python中的Selenium禁用Webdriver的控制台输出

我正在尝试运行一个使用Selenium和Chrome分析一些网站数据的Python程序。问题是,Selenium或Webdriver会在控制台输出许多我不关心的内容,使得查看程序输出变得困难。我已经阅读了许多其他关于此问题的线程,使用了各种驱动选项,但似乎都无法解决。这些选项最好的效果就是移除...